The mass m , stiffness k and the natural frequency Wn of an undamped Single degree of freedom system are unknown. These properties are to be determined by harmonic excitation tests. At an excitation frequency of 4 Hz, the response tends to increase without bound(ie a resonant condition). Next, a weight of deltaW= 5lb is attached to the mass m and the resonance test is repeated. This time resonance occurs at a frequency of 3 Hz. Determine the mass and the stiffness of the system.
